Gathering Your Equipment
Essential Components
Before you begin, make sure you have all the necessary equipment. The good news is that you won’t need a complicated setup with multiple power sources or extensive wiring.

- PoE IP Camera: Your surveillance device comes with mounting hardware and mounting brackets
- PoE Switch or Injector: Either a switch with built-in PoE capability or a separate power injector
- Cat5e, Cat6, or Cat6a Ethernet Cable: Standard networking cable (up to 100 feet recommended)
- Router/Network Hub: Your existing internet-connected device
- Computer or Smartphone: For initial configuration and testing
- Phillips Head Screwdriver: For mounting the camera
Understanding PoE Technology
Power over Ethernet (PoE) technology allows you to transmit both data and electrical power through a single Ethernet cable. This innovation has revolutionized IP camera installations by eliminating the need for separate power adapters and outlets near each camera location.
Modern PoE systems use IEEE 802.3af/at/bt standards, which can deliver up to 90 watts of power through standard Ethernet cables. Most IP cameras require between 4-15 watts, making them perfect candidates for PoE implementation.
Planning Your Installation
Camera Placement Strategy
Strategic camera placement is crucial for effective surveillance. Consider these factors when positioning your camera:
- Entry Points: Focus on doors, windows, and main entrances first
- Coverage Areas: Aim for overlapping fields of view where possible
- Lighting Conditions: Avoid direct sunlight and ensure adequate illumination
- Height Requirements: Mount at least 7-10 feet high for optimal coverage and vandal resistance
- Weather Protection: Choose weatherproof models for outdoor installations
Network Infrastructure Assessment
Evaluate your existing network infrastructure before installation:
- Bandwidth Calculation: Each IP camera typically uses 2-8 Mbps bandwidth
- Switch Capacity: Ensure your PoE switch has enough ports and power budget
- Cable Management: Plan cable routing to avoid tripping hazards and maintain aesthetics
- Future Expansion: Leave extra ports available for additional cameras
Step-by-Step Connection Process
Step 1: Mount the Camera
Start by securely mounting your camera according to the manufacturer’s specifications:
- Position the mounting bracket where you want to install the camera
- Mark screw holes with a pencil or marker
- Drill pilot holes and secure the bracket with appropriate anchors
- Attach the camera to the bracket using the provided screws
- Adjust the camera angle for optimal coverage
Step 2: Connect the Ethernet Cable
This is the core connection that enables both power and data transmission:
- Run your Ethernet cable from the camera location to your network switch
- Connect one end to the camera’s Ethernet port
- Connect the other end to your PoE-enabled switch or injector
- Ensure all connections are snug and secure
- Allow the camera to power up (usually indicated by LED lights)
Step 3: Configure Network Settings
Once connected, configure your camera’s network settings:
- Connect your computer to the same network as the camera
- Access the camera’s web interface through a browser
- Use the default IP address (usually found in the manual or on the camera label)
- Change default login credentials immediately
- Update network settings if using DHCP or assigning static IP
Network Configuration Details
IP Address Assignment
Determine whether your camera should use DHCP or static IP addressing:
- DHCP (Recommended): Automatically assigns IP addresses from your router
- Static IP: Manually assign a fixed IP address for consistent access
- Subnet Mask: Typically 255.255.255.0 for home networks
- Default Gateway: Usually your router’s IP address
- DNS Server: Your ISP’s DNS or public DNS like Google (8.8.8.8)
Port Forwarding Setup
Configure port forwarding to access your camera remotely:
- Log into your router’s admin panel
- Find the Port Forwarding section
- Add a new rule for your camera’s HTTP/HTTPS ports (typically 80/443)
- Set the internal IP address to match your camera’s assigned address
- Save changes and test remote access

Troubleshooting Common Issues
No Power or Data Connection
If your camera isn’t receiving power or establishing a network connection:
- Check PoE Compatibility: Verify your switch or injector supports the required PoE standard
- Inspect Cables: Look for damaged or improperly connected Ethernet cables
- Test with Known Good Cable: Replace suspect cables with confirmed working ones
- Reset Camera: Some cameras have reset buttons for recovery
- Check Power Budget: Ensure your PoE switch has sufficient remaining power capacity
Intermittent Connectivity Problems
Address unstable connections and frequent disconnections:
- Cable Length: Stay within the 100-meter limit for reliable performance
- Electrical Interference: Keep Ethernet cables away from power lines and transformers
- Heat Dissipation: Ensure adequate ventilation around PoE switches
- Firmware Updates: Install latest firmware for stability improvements
- Network Congestion: Reduce bandwidth usage from other devices during peak hours

Security Considerations
Protect your surveillance system from unauthorized access:
- Change Default Passwords: Always use strong, unique passwords
- Enable Encryption: Use HTTPS and WPA3 encryption where available
- Regular Updates: Keep firmware current to patch security vulnerabilities
- Firewall Rules: Limit external access to only necessary ports
- Guest Networks: Consider placing cameras on isolated networks
